Barrett’s Esophagus Treatment Market: Introduction

Barrett’s Esophagus (BE) is a precancerous condition characterized by the replacement of normal esophageal lining with intestinal-type tissue, primarily due to chronic g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). This condition significantly increases the risk of developing esophageal adenocarcinoma, making early detection and effective management crucial. The Barrett’s Esophagus Treatment Market encompasses a wide range of diagnostic, therapeutic, and surgical interventions aimed at preventing disease progression, alleviating symptoms, and reducing cancer risks.

Advances in endoscopic technologies, molecular diagnostics, and targeted therapies have enhanced the ability of healthcare professionals to identify and treat Barrett’s Esophagus at an early stage. Additionally, the global rise in GERD prevalence, obesity, and unhealthy lifestyle habits is contributing to the expansion of the BE patient pool, thereby driving market growth.

The market outlook remains positive due to increasing awareness among patients and physicians about early intervention and the growing integration of artificial intelligence (AI) in endoscopic imaging for better visualization of dysplastic lesions. Barrett’s Esophagus Treatment Market: Trends and Opportunities

The global Barrett’s Esophagus Treatment Market is undergoing rapid transformation, supported by continuous innovation in diagnostics, treatment modalities, and personalized care strategies. Increasing integration of AI-assisted endoscopy and optical coherence tomography (OCT) systems has significantly improved the early detection of dysplasia, allowing clinicians to make accurate, real-time decisions during endoscopic procedures.

Minimally invasive and non-surgical treatments are gaining strong traction, particularly radiofrequency ablation, photodynamic therapy, and cryotherapy, as they provide effective outcomes with shorter recovery times. The ongoing shift from surgical interventions to endoscopic management represents a major cost and comfort advantage for both patients and providers.

Pharmaceutical advancements, including the development of proton pump inhibitors (PPIs), antireflux drugs, and chemoprevention agents, continue to complement procedural therapies. Additionally, ongoing research into molecular biomarkers and genetic testing is opening new pathways for early diagnosis and customized treatment approaches.
